AI Technical Writer job description
Job Summary
We are seeking an experienced AI Technical Writer to develop and govern structured knowledge used by production AI agents. This role focuses on transforming engineering documentation, source code, configurations, standards, and technical knowledge into concise, structured content that AI systems can accurately retrieve and use. The ideal candidate has strong technical writing, information architecture, documentation governance, and Docs-as-Code experience.
Key Responsibilities
Create service overviews, runbooks, technical specifications, schemas, standards, and glossary documentation.
Develop concise summaries that improve AI knowledge retrieval.
Design taxonomies, metadata, indexes, cross-links, and structured documentation.
Apply metadata to organize content by domain, system, and AI use cases.
Author AI prompts, reusable skills, agent instructions, and supporting documentation.
Convert engineering, security, governance, and platform standards into version-controlled documentation.
Interview engineering teams to capture technical decisions and implementation details.
Manage documentation through governance, security, compliance, and approval workflows.
Maintain naming conventions, controlled vocabularies, and glossary definitions.
Review, update, archive, and retire outdated documentation.
Work within Git-based documentation workflows using pull requests and validation processes.
Requirements
Required Qualifications
5+ years of technical writing experience in software, infrastructure, platform engineering, or related technical environments.
3+ years of document control, content governance, or controlled documentation experience.
Experience creating documentation from source code, configurations, specifications, and engineering runbooks.
Strong information architecture skills including taxonomy, metadata, indexing, and cross-linking.
Experience writing technical manuals, standards, reference documentation, and technical specifications.
Strong terminology management and vocabulary governance skills.
Experience collaborating with developers, engineers, architects, and governance teams.
Hands-on experience with Markdown, Git, version control, and Docs-as-Code workflows.
Excellent technical writing skills with the ability to write concise, structured documentation.
Must be able to work in a hybrid environment in Farmington Hills, MI.
Preferred Qualifications
Experience writing AI prompts, agent instructions, reusable AI skills, or LLM documentation.
Understanding of AI retrieval systems, context windows, and context management.
Experience with YAML, JSON frontmatter, schemas, and structured content.
Familiarity with AI orchestration, retrieval systems, or Model Context Protocol (MCP).
Experience with Git workflows, pull requests, CI validation, and CLI-based documentation.
Knowledge of ontologies, knowledge graphs, semantic models, or controlled vocabularies.
Basic understanding of Python, TypeScript, Terraform, or YAML.
Experience in regulated industries such as Banking, Financial Services, or Cybersecurity.
